Transaction 63e543e616af3818ef336b2ca7db5f66342b8569205cab8fa8c39db613a06a87

2 Input
2 Outputs
  • 63e543e616af3818ef336b2ca7db5f66342b8569205cab8fa8c39db613a06a87:0
  • value  1015014
    address  173T2iZpn8yUzvRT8AoE2orNeu1t5og9Fq
  • 63e543e616af3818ef336b2ca7db5f66342b8569205cab8fa8c39db613a06a87:1
  • value  1159084
    address  1CAKXUSYaFphq5ZvAmqrPcAugjpf8beWxX